The Role
- Carrying out Management, Refurbishment & Demolition (R&D) asbestos surveys in line with HSG264
- Undertaking air monitoring, including 4-stage clearances and reoccupation certification
- Conducting bulk sampling and ensuring compliance with procedures
- Producing accurate, compliant reports in line with HSG264 and HSG248
- Managing workload across multiple sites throughout the East Midlands
- Liaising with clients, contractors, and internal teams
- Maintaining high standards of health & safety and quality
About You
- BOHS P402, P403 & P404 (essential)
- Experience working in a dual Surveyor / Analyst role
- Strong understanding of asbestos legislation and compliance
- Ability to manage workload independently
- Full UK driving licence
- Professional, organised, and reliable
